Alpha Trains Orders 15 More Siemens Vectron Dual-Mode Locomotives

Alpha Trains has placed an order for 15 more Vectron Dual-Mode locomotives from Siemens Mobility. The exact delivery date remains unspecified. These advanced locomotives are seen as intelligent and sustainable solutions by Vincent Pouyet, CEO of the Locomotives business area at Alpha Trains.

The order is part of the framework agreement signed in July 2024. The Vectron Dual-Mode locomotives can operate on both electrified and non-electrified tracks, making them versatile for various routes. They will join the existing Alpha Trains fleet of Vectron AC, MS, and Dual-Mode models, supplementing the fleet's capabilities.

Andre Rodenbeck, CEO Rolling Stock at Siemens Mobility, welcomed Alpha Trains' decision to expand their fleet with more Dual-Mode locomotives. These new locomotives, intended for use in Germany and Austria, offer a maximum power output of 2.4 megawatts in electric mode and 2 megawatts in diesel mode. They can reach speeds of up to 160 km/h, ensuring efficient and timely transport services. Additionally, Siemens Mobility will provide maintenance services for the newly ordered Vectron fleet through a service contract with Alpha Trains.
